BERLIN (Reuters) - EU foreign policy chief Catherine Ashton said on Friday it was crucial to see a reduction in violence and the occupation of buildings in crisis-stricken Ukraine.
"It is absolutely vital that we do not see continuing violence, it's absolutely vital that we see occupations of buildings reduced," she said during a joint press conference with German Foreign Minister Frank-Walter Steinmeier in Berlin.
